当前位置: 首页> 汽车> 新车 > qq推广链接_seo优化的主要内容_精准营销的成功案例_产品网络推广深圳

qq推广链接_seo优化的主要内容_精准营销的成功案例_产品网络推广深圳

时间:2025/7/11 3:44:14来源:https://blog.csdn.net/z18072129907/article/details/146810299 浏览次数: 0次
qq推广链接_seo优化的主要内容_精准营销的成功案例_产品网络推广深圳

PHP作为全球最流行的Web开发语言之一,在PHP 8.x版本中迎来了重大革新。从JIT编译器到类型系统强化,从Composer依赖管理到Laravel等现代框架的崛起,PHP生态正在重塑高效、安全的开发范式。

一、性能革命:JIT加速与内存优化

PHP 8引入的JIT(即时编译器)使脚本执行速度提升3倍,尤其适合计算密集型任务。配合OPcache预编译,响应延迟显著降低。开发者可通过opcache.enable_cli配置在命令行启用缓存,或在Laravel中使用路由缓存php artisan route:cache进一步提升性能。

二、类型系统进化:严格模式与联合类型
 

php复制代码

// PHP 8联合类型示例
function processValue(int|float $value): void {
// 类型安全的数值处理
}

通过declare(strict_types=1)启用严格模式,配合联合类型声明,代码健壮性得到质的飞跃。IDE的智能提示和静态分析工具(如Psalm)能提前捕获类型错误。

三、现代开发实践:Composer与依赖管理
 

bash复制代码

# 初始化项目并安装Laravel
composer create-project laravel/laravel myapp

Composer已成为PHP依赖管理的标配,其自动加载机制(PSR-4)让类加载效率提升50%。结合Packagist仓库,开发者可快速集成GuzzleHTTP、Symfony组件等优质库。

四、安全开发准则:防御性编程
  1. 输入验证:使用filter_var()严格校验用户输入
  2. SQL防护:PDO预处理语句+ATTR_EMULATE_PREPARES=false
  3. 依赖审计:定期运行composer audit检查漏洞
  4. HTTPS强化:设置HSTS头并强制重定向
五、框架选择策略:Laravel vs Symfony

特性LaravelSymfony
学习曲线平缓(Eloquent ORM)较陡(依赖注入体系)
生态扩展丰富(Jetstream/Spark)灵活(Bundle机制)
适用场景快速开发Web应用企业级复杂系统
六、未来趋势:Serverless与PHP

通过Bref等无服务器框架,PHP可轻松部署至AWS Lambda。事件驱动架构下,PHP的微服务化成为可能,配合Swoole扩展甚至能实现常驻内存服务。

PHP 8.x正引领着从脚本语言向企业级平台的蜕变。开发者应拥抱类型系统、掌握Composer生态、遵循安全规范,并探索Serverless等新范式。正如PHP官方标语所言:"PHP is all around you",持续进化的PHP将继续塑造Web开发的未来。

关键字:qq推广链接_seo优化的主要内容_精准营销的成功案例_产品网络推广深圳

版权声明:

本网仅为发布的内容提供存储空间,不对发表、转载的内容提供任何形式的保证。凡本网注明“来源:XXX网络”的作品,均转载自其它媒体,著作权归作者所有,商业转载请联系作者获得授权,非商业转载请注明出处。

我们尊重并感谢每一位作者,均已注明文章来源和作者。如因作品内容、版权或其它问题,请及时与我们联系,联系邮箱:809451989@qq.com,投稿邮箱:809451989@qq.com

责任编辑: